On Thursday night the Bay Area’s own Kamala Harris will accept the nomination as the Democratic party’s presidential candidate after days of full throated embraces of her candidacy at the Democratic National Convention. KQED’s politics team joins us from the convention in Chicago to analyze notable moments from the convention and whether the party is embracing, or distancing itself, from Harris’ California roots and legacy.

Guests:

Marisa Lagos, politics correspondent, KQED; co-host of KQED's Political Breakdown

Scott Shafer, senior editor, KQED’s California Politics and Government; co-host, Political Breakdown

Guy Marzorati, correspondent, KQED's California Politics and Government Desk
